Responsive Design Tips for Wild Inferno on Mobile Screens

When using Wild Inferno in responsive web design, especially for mobile, it's best reserved for short, impactful text. Due to the nature of blackletter fonts, long paragraphs in Wild Inferno can reduce readability on smaller screens. Instead, use it for section headings, buttons, or logo text. Pair it with a clean sans serif font for body copy to maintain a balanced visual hierarchy that supports both brand tone and user experience.

Font Pairing Strategies with Wild Inferno for Web Design

To make the most of Wild Inferno in digital layouts, pair it with simpler, more legible typefaces. A modern sans serif like Montserrat or Open Sans works well for body text and navigation menus, creating a balanced contrast that guides the user’s eye. Alternatively, for editorial-style websites or portfolios, consider pairing Wild Inferno with a serif font for subheadings or quote text, maintaining a cohesive yet dynamic typographic voice.

Ensuring Webfont Compatibility and Licensing for Wild Inferno

Before using Wild Inferno on live websites or client projects, verify that it includes webfont formats like WOFF or EOT. Most modern font marketplaces provide these by default, but it's always good to double-check. Also, ensure you have the proper commercial font license for web use, especially when embedding it into online stores, landing pages, or SaaS dashboards. A properly licensed font protects both you and your clients from legal issues down the line.

Best Practices for Using Wild Inferno on Dark and Light Backgrounds

Wild Inferno performs well on both light and dark backgrounds, but each requires careful consideration. On white or light backgrounds, the font's bold lines create high contrast, making it ideal for call-to-action buttons or featured headlines. On dark backgrounds, especially in hero sections or overlay text on images, ensure there’s enough spacing and contrast to maintain readability. Adding a subtle stroke or shadow can help the font pop without sacrificing clarity.
